Ready Your Vegetation:

One of the more essential areas of winterizing your outdoor area is planning your vegetation for the cold weather. Start by getting rid of any lifeless or infected foliage to prevent the distributed of sickness in the dormant period. Following, use a level of compost throughout the base of trees, shrubs, and perennials to insulate the soil and safeguard roots from cold temps. Think about wrapping fine plants and flowers with burlap or frost material to deliver another level of protection against frost and blowing wind damage. Moreover, proceed irrigating your plant life until the soil freezes to guarantee they enter in winter well-hydrated.

Drain and Shield H2o Characteristics:

Normal water characteristics like ponds, water fountains, and birdbaths call for unique interest just before winter months packages directly into protect against problems from very cold h2o. Begin with draining and washing your normal water functions to eliminate debris and algae that may cause problems through the winter. If you can, remove pumps and filtration systems and retailer them indoors to prevent harm from cold temperature ranges. Think about the installation of a hovering de-icer or even a pond water heater to maintain water from freezing totally, which can help maintain a habitat for animals and prevent damage to pumping systems and plumbing.

Protect Pipes and Watering Techniques:

Frosty pipes and watering systems could cause high priced damage to your outdoor space. Ahead of the first freeze, insulate uncovered piping and watering outlines with foam heat retaining material sleeves or temperature tape in order to avoid very cold. Disconnect and empty hoses, then retail store them inside to safeguard them from damage. In case you have an underground irrigation process, consider possessing it professionally winterized to get rid of any outstanding drinking water and stop cold and harm to plumbing and sprinkler heads.

Maintain Pathways and Drive ways:

Safe and reachable pathways and drive-ways are essential during the winter season in order to avoid slips, travels, and falls. Before wintertime shows up, check your walkways and drive-ways for holes, irregular surfaces, along with other dangers. Maintenance any damage and apply a cover of sealant to guard against dampness penetration and hold-thaw periods. Think about using eco-pleasant de-icing goods including calcium supplements magnesium acetate or beach sand rather than conventional rock and roll salt, which is often damaging to plant life and animals.
